"The Adventures of King Pistachio" is a Platformer, where you have to kill spoons, jump ice cream platforms and avoid fireballs... Really!
Theme: Empire Game on Ice Cream
"The Ice Creamgdom is being attacked by the terrible Snowman and the only hope is that the old Pistachio King bravely fight and destroy the Snowman and all of his Spoon Troopers."
← → (Move)
↑ (Jump)
Spacebar (Attack)

I had a lot of fun playing through this. The platforming was very simple but the addition of the fireballs falling from the sky made things a _lot_ more interesting. I had to constantly be looking in two places, but dodging the fireballs really forced me to think about positioning a lot, which was fun. The art was very simple, but it was immediately apparent to me what everything did, including the falling platforms. The timing and movement on the platforms and fireballs was done really well. I never felt like it was totally unfair except for on the last boss which I was able to figure out after a few attempts. The collision detection was a little wonky (which I used to my benefit) i.e. you could jump through a platform and then be inside of it, which made the game quite a bit easier than it probably should have, but it also made the game feel a lot better, especially since I died a lot and had to restart. The earlier levels were still fun to go through since I was experimenting and getting better with the controls. Thanks for letting me play your game! Hope you can come back and do another LD!
